This Italian Lemon Cream Cake combines the zestful tang of lemons with the rich, silky texture of mascarpone cream. Perfect for any occasion, it's a dessert that promises to impress with its balance of sweet and tart flavors.
Prepare the Cake: Cream butter and sugar until fluffy. Add eggs one at a time, followed by lemon zest. Gradually mix in dry ingredients alternately with milk until just combined.
Bake: Pour batter into prepared pan. Bake until a toothpick inserted comes out clean. Let cool.
Prepare the Filling: Whip together mascarpone, heavy cream, powdered sugar, lemon juice, and zest until smooth.
Assemble: Cut the cake horizontally. Spread filling between layers and on top. Chill before serving.
Notes
For a lighter filling, you can use whipped cream mixed with lemon curd instead of mascarpone.
The cake tastes best when served at room temperature, allowing the flavors to fully emerge.
Lemon zest adds a vibrant burst of flavor; use organic lemons if possible to avoid pesticide residues.
